11. Indeed I waited for your words,I listened to your reasonings, while you searched out what to say.
12. I paid close attention to you;And surely not one of you convinced Job,Or answered his words—
13. Lest you say,‘We have found wisdom’;God will vanquish him, not man.
14. Now he has not directed his words against me;So I will not answer him with your words.
15. “They are dismayed and answer no more;Words escape them.
16. And I have waited, because they did not speak,Because they stood still and answered no more.
17. I also will answer my part,I too will declare my opinion.
18. For I am full of words;The spirit within me compels me.
19. Indeed my belly is like wine that has no vent;It is ready to burst like new wineskins.
20. I will speak, that I may find relief;I must open my lips and answer.
21. Let me not, I pray, show partiality to anyone;Nor let me flatter any man.
22. For I do not know how to flatter,Else my Maker would soon take me away.
